Luke Banitsiotis has taken out this year's Australasian Auctioneering Championships (AUSTROS) in Hobart. This was the Woodards Blackburn agent’s forth finals appearance and he beat out some of the industry's best auctioneers, with the final featuring Alec Brown, Bronte Manuel, Clarence White and Paul Hancock. The event was part of the ANZ REIA 100 Gala, which also saw the industry name its top performers for 2024. Check out all the highlights here.

Do rates really matter?

More than one-third of Aussie homebuyers say interest rates don’t impact their decision on whether to buy or sell property. According to preliminary findings from InfoTrack’s 2024 State of Real Estate Report: Insights from Australian Buyers and Sellers, 37 per cent of respondents don’t view interest rates as a major factor in whether they transact or not. The research also shows 27 per cent of survey respondents list property prices as the main challenge in their buying decisions, followed by 20 per cent who cite market conditions. More here.

Meanwhile in Japan 🇯🇵

Unpacking Akiya: The Empty Houses in Japan

In rural Japan, millions of abandoned homes, known as Akiya, are sold for shockingly low prices, attracting a growing number of American buyers. The homes, often abandoned due to the original owner's death or heirs refusing the inheritance, are part of a government push to revitalise rural areas. Despite the challenges of obtaining mortgages for non-residents, the allure of cheap property and potential renovation projects draws international interest. With the help of firms like Akiya & Inaka, foreigners are navigating the simple yet language-barrier process of investing in these unique opportunities. More here.
